Union Leaders Vow To Avoid Strikes
The Chairman, Agricul
tural and Allied Employees Union of Nigeria ( AAEUN) Niger Delta Basin Development Authority (NDBDA) Branch, Comrade Nwafor Nkiken, says his union will no long use strike action as an option.
The AAEUN leader, gave the assurance last week in Port Harcourt during the occasion of staff award organised by the management.
Nkiken said the decision was pursuant to the task of keeping the authority on a steady path of growth.
He noted that strike was no more an option in any struggle for better condition of service, adding that it impacts negatively on the future of workers.
According to him, the union was bent on delivering its mandate to transform the authority with the aim of making it a world class organization.
He, among other things, called attention to some challenges facing the union, saying that until such problems are addressed, the goals of the organisation’s founding fathers would not be realised.
Earlier in her address, the Managing Director, NDBDA, Hon Onoye Beredugo, tasked workers on productivity.
She said the reason for the award was to encourage workers in their various departments and the need to be committed to duty.
Beredugo pointed out that the awardees were carefully selected and ruled out any form of favouratism in the process.
She also thanked workers and staff for keeping faith with the corporation despite the challenges.
The award came in 10 categories with three beneficiaries in each, totalling 30 awardees in all.
